Northern Tier Expedition – Since 1923, Scouts have been voyaging into the great north wilderness to seek adventure. Eagles soaring overhead, walleye swimming in the depths of pristine lakes, meeting a moose on the portage trail. These are the experiences that Scouts get in Canada and the north woods of the United States.  Northern Tier High Adventure Program is the ONLY outfitter in the Boundary Waters Canoe Area and Canada charged by the Boy Scouts of America to deliver the Scouting program to Scouts and Leaders adventuring into North Americas Canoe Country.
 
Troop 919 is considering putting together a trek to the BSA’s Northern Tier High Adventure base in 2011 and we will be discussing the possibility of this Troop at our November Court of Honor.
 
The minimum requirements for Scouts to participate in this program is to be 13 years old by December 31, 2011, be classified as a swimmer by BSA standards and meet (not exceed) the Northern Tier height/weight standards.
